Output 651baf0d5db6e2a7c81f2b53155f5db5c4a819aa26fd9324cb195c3b35228324:4

value
1000302
script pubkey
OP_0 OP_PUSHBYTES_20 16fd1d66fa4d53f5cb6c477a3037ca04516828b6
address
tb1qzm736eh6f4fltjmvgaarqd72q3gks29kjlvyvc
transaction
651baf0d5db6e2a7c81f2b53155f5db5c4a819aa26fd9324cb195c3b35228324